
Sporting a convex stainless steel door frame against the backdrop of a black cabinet, the Avanti WC30SSR Built-In Wine Chiller projects style and flair that is sure to make its surroundings look better than they really are. A curved door handle, also made of stainless steel, adorns the frame.
Visible through the glass door are the wood trims of five wire rack shelves, further enhancing the refrigerator’s elegance. The door is double-paned to keep cool air inside the refrigerator and hot air outside. It is also tinted to keep ultraviolet rays from damaging the wine.
There are actually six shelves but the one at the bottom is concealed by the door frame. The shelves are scalloped to keep the wine bottles from rolling over and agitating the wine sediments inside.
The upper five shelves can accommodate five Bordeaux or Burgundy bottles each, while the bottom shelf is designed to hold five Magnum or even Jeroboams, for a total of 30 bottles.
The bottom of the door frame incorporates a locking mechanism to secure your wine collection. Further below is an air vent with a stainless steel grille, which allows either for a built-in or freestanding installation.
The Avanti WC30SSR relies on a compressor with an automatic defrost system for cooling your wines. It has a temperature range of 40° to 65°F, thus you can chill all types of wines, including Champagne, Muscat, Pinot Noir, Beaujolais, Bordeaux, or Cabernet Sauvignon.
Controlling temperature levels is done through a soft touch control panel mounted just below the top door frame. It includes an LED display indicating the temperature inside the refrigerator, on/off button, up and down arrow buttons for temperature adjustment, and a timer button for time setting.
Dimensions of the Avanti WC30SSR Built-In Wine Chiller are 34″H x 15″ W x 25″ D, while its weight is 67 pounds.
